概括
本研究引入了基于表情符号的多功能融合情绪分析模型 (EMFSA),以改进短文本分析. EMFSA模型通过整合表情符号,主题和文本功能来增强情绪表达和情感准确性.

背景情况:
- 社交媒体上的短文往往缺乏情感深度,而具有丰富的功能.
- 挑战包括语义模两可和稀疏的数据,妨碍准确的情绪分析.
研究的目的:
- 为了提高短文的情感分析准确度.
- 提出一个有效的模型,从短文中提取情感语义.
主要方法:
- 开发了一个基于emoji的多功能融合情绪分析模型 (EMFSA).
- 采用一种预训练方法来提取特征,以及一种情感和表情符号掩盖的语言模型.
- 利用交叉注意力机制进行多功能融合,整合表情符号,主题和文本功能.
主要成果:
- 根据EMFSA模型,三个公共数据集的准确性得到了显著改善.
- 与基线方法相比,获得了2.3%,10.9%和2.7%的准确度增长.
- 有效地增强了情感的语义表达和情感表示准确度.
结论:
- 建议的EMFSA模型有效地解决了短文情绪分析的局限性.
- 多功能融合,特别是结合表情符号语义,对于提高准确性至关重要.
- 该模型显示了社交媒体分析中现实应用的巨大潜力.

Some researchers suggest that altruism operates on empathy. Empathy is the capacity to understand another person’s perspective, to feel what he or she feels. An empathetic person makes an emotional connection with others and feels compelled to help (Batson, 1991). Empathy can be expressed in several ways, including cognitive, affective, and motor.

Magnetic flux depends on three factors: the strength of the magnetic field, the area through which the field lines pass, and the field's orientation with respect to the surface area. If any of these quantities vary, a corresponding variation in magnetic flux occurs. If the area through which the magnetic field lines are passing changes, then the magnetic flux also changes.
